MR. JUSTICE CULBERTSON delivered the opinion of the court.

This is an appeal from a judgment of the county court of Bond county in the sum of $1,500 in favor of appellee, Raymond Haberer (hereinafter called plaintiff), as against appellants, Moorman Manufacturing Company, a corporation, and Launer Hoffman (hereinafter called defendants). The cause was tried by a jury and the judgment was based on the verdict of the jury in the sum of $1,500.
